1. Battery depletion

Probably the most frequent explanation for a Toyota distant entry gadget ceasing to perform is battery depletion. The gadget depends on a small battery to transmit indicators to the car’s receiver. Because the battery discharges, the sign power diminishes, ultimately changing into too weak for the car to acknowledge. For instance, an proprietor would possibly discover the distant entry gadget working intermittently, requiring nearer proximity to the car earlier than failing totally. This direct relationship between battery cost degree and operational vary underscores the significance of sustaining enough energy inside the distant entry gadget.

Common use accelerates battery drainage, and environmental elements, reminiscent of excessive temperatures, can even have an effect on battery lifespan. The kind of battery used, typically a CR2032 or comparable coin cell battery, is designed for longevity, however its restricted capability necessitates periodic substitute. A car proprietor experiencing a sudden cessation of distant entry perform ought to first take into account battery substitute as the only and most possible resolution. For example, changing the battery typically restores performance and eliminates the necessity for extra advanced diagnostic procedures.

In abstract, battery depletion represents a major think about distant entry gadget failure. Whereas different potential causes exist, addressing the battery is the preliminary step in troubleshooting. Sustaining consciousness of battery life and proactively changing it will possibly stop surprising operational disruptions, guaranteeing continued comfort and safety for the car operator.

2. Synchronization loss

Synchronization loss, referring to the disruption of the programmed communication hyperlink between a Toyota car and its distant entry gadget, represents a major issue contributing to the gadget’s non-functionality. This loss prevents the gadget from correctly sending and receiving indicators, successfully rendering it unable to regulate car capabilities reminiscent of locking, unlocking, or beginning the engine. A standard state of affairs includes a driver urgent the unlock button, solely to seek out the car unresponsive, regardless of a functioning battery inside the distant entry gadget. Synchronization loss is important to understanding as a element of the distant entry system’s operational integrity.

A number of elements can induce synchronization loss. Battery substitute within the car or the distant entry gadget itself can generally erase the saved programming. Moreover, radio frequency interference, electrical disturbances, or makes an attempt to reprogram the gadget improperly can disrupt the established communication protocol. For instance, disconnecting the car’s battery throughout upkeep could inadvertently reset the system, requiring the distant entry gadget to be re-synchronized. The sensible implication of synchronization loss is that even a bodily sound distant entry gadget turns into ineffective with out the proper programming.

Efficiently re-establishing synchronization usually necessitates a particular programming sequence, typically involving turning the ignition on and off in a exact method whereas concurrently urgent buttons on the distant entry gadget. The process varies relying on the car mannequin. In some circumstances, knowledgeable locksmith or dealership service technician should use specialised diagnostic gear to reprogram the gadget. Due to this fact, understanding the idea of synchronization loss and its potential causes permits car homeowners to successfully troubleshoot distant entry gadget points and take applicable corrective motion.

3. Receiver malfunction

A receiver malfunction instantly contributes to a non-functional Toyota distant entry gadget. The receiver, a element inside the car, is answerable for intercepting and decoding radio frequency indicators transmitted by the gadget. When the receiver fails, it can not course of these indicators, rendering the distant entry gadget ineffective. For example, urgent the lock button on the distant entry gadget will produce no response from the car if the receiver is malfunctioning. The failure of this single element negates the utility of your entire distant entry system.

A number of elements could cause receiver malfunction, together with electrical surges, bodily harm from collisions or water intrusion, and element degradation over time. For instance, a sudden energy surge might harm the receiver’s inside circuitry, disrupting its capability to perform. Equally, water harm could corrode electrical connections inside the receiver unit, resulting in intermittent or full failure. Correct analysis of a receiver malfunction usually necessitates specialised diagnostic gear to confirm sign reception and processing capabilities. Knowledgeable technician could use a scan instrument to verify for error codes associated to the distant entry system, or a multimeter to check voltage and continuity on the receiver.

Figuring out and addressing receiver malfunction is essential for restoring distant entry gadget performance. Ignoring this potential situation might lead to pointless substitute of the distant entry gadget itself, with out resolving the underlying drawback. Efficient analysis and restore, which can contain changing the defective receiver unit, are important for guaranteeing the system’s correct operation. This understanding is significant for car homeowners and repair technicians alike when addressing situations of a Toyota distant entry gadget ceasing to function.

5. Interference (sign)

Sign interference represents a circumstantial issue that may quickly inhibit the performance of a Toyota distant entry gadget. Whereas the gadget itself and the car’s receiver is perhaps working accurately, exterior radio frequency indicators can disrupt communication, resulting in a brief incapacity to remotely management the car. Understanding the character and sources of such interference is essential for troubleshooting situations when the gadget ceases to perform as anticipated.

  • Radio Frequency Overlap

    Quite a few units transmit radio frequency (RF) indicators, doubtlessly overlapping with the frequency utilized by the distant entry gadget. This overlap can create a “jamming” impact, stopping the car’s receiver from precisely decoding the gadget’s sign. Examples embody airport radars, radio transmission towers, and sure client electronics. The impression is that the gadget seems non-functional in particular places, resuming regular operation elsewhere.

  • Electromagnetic Fields

    Sturdy electromagnetic fields generated by industrial gear or energy traces can disrupt RF communication. These fields introduce noise into the atmosphere, obscuring the sign transmitted by the distant entry gadget. The result’s an intermittent lack of performance, typically localized to areas close to the supply of the electromagnetic area.

  • Sign Blocking

    Bodily obstructions, reminiscent of buildings with metallic buildings or dense foliage, can block or attenuate the sign from the distant entry gadget. The sign power diminishes to a degree the place the car’s receiver can not detect it. Consequently, the gadget may go reliably in open areas however fail to perform inside enclosed or obstructed environments.

  • Different Wi-fi Units

    The proliferation of wi-fi units working on comparable frequencies can contribute to common sign litter, rising the probability of interference. Bluetooth units, Wi-Fi routers, and different wi-fi communication techniques can introduce noise and competitors for accessible bandwidth. In densely populated areas with quite a few wi-fi units, this may result in extra frequent situations of distant entry gadget malfunction.

The results of sign interference on the Toyota distant entry gadget are usually transient and location-dependent. Shifting the car or the consumer a brief distance can typically resolve the problem. Whereas addressing the supply of interference is usually impractical, understanding this phenomenon helps customers differentiate between non permanent disruptions and extra critical underlying issues with the gadget or car’s receiver, permitting for applicable troubleshooting steps. Figuring out interference because the trigger can stop pointless restore makes an attempt or element replacements.

8. System fault

A system fault, within the context of a Toyota distant entry gadget malfunction, refers to an error inside the car’s onboard pc techniques that govern the distant keyless entry. This encompasses a variety of potential failures, extending past easy battery depletion or synchronization loss. This typically advanced malfunction prevents communication between the gadget and car. Due to this fact, diagnosing system fault circumstances requires methodical examination by skilled professionals.

  • CAN Bus Communication Failure

    The Controller Space Community (CAN) bus allows totally different digital management models (ECUs) inside the car to speak. If the CAN bus experiences a fault, messages from the distant entry receiver could not attain the ECU answerable for unlocking the doorways or beginning the engine. The result’s that the gadget turns into non-responsive, even when the receiver and gadget are functioning accurately. Such a state of affairs calls for superior diagnostic gear to detect and rectify the CAN bus communication drawback.

  • Physique Management Module (BCM) Malfunction

    The BCM manages numerous body-related capabilities, together with the distant keyless entry system. A malfunction inside the BCM, reminiscent of corrupted software program or {hardware} failure, can stop it from processing indicators from the distant entry gadget. For instance, the BCM may not activate the door locks even when receiving the proper sign. Resolving BCM-related faults typically requires reprogramming the module or, in extreme circumstances, changing it totally.

  • Immobilizer System Error

    The immobilizer system is designed to stop car theft by disabling the engine until a sound key’s current. A fault inside the immobilizer system can incorrectly stop the car from recognizing the distant entry gadget, even when the gadget is accurately programmed. This could manifest because the car failing to start out, accompanied by a non-functional distant entry system. Rectifying immobilizer points typically includes resetting or reprogramming the system by a licensed technician.

  • Wiring Harness Harm

    The wiring harness connects numerous elements of the distant entry system, together with the receiver, BCM, and door lock actuators. Bodily harm to the wiring harness, reminiscent of corrosion, breaks, or shorts, can disrupt communication between these elements. For instance, a damaged wire resulting in the door lock actuators would stop the doorways from unlocking remotely. Repairing wiring harness harm requires cautious inspection and infrequently includes changing broken sections of the harness.

These system defects spotlight that the Toyota distant entry gadget is a part of an intricate community of interconnected elements. Resolving a non-functional gadget necessitates a complete method, extending past easy troubleshooting steps. Skilled diagnostics and specialised gear are sometimes important to establish and rectify system-level points, thereby restoring the distant entry system to correct operation.

Steadily Requested Questions

The next addresses frequent inquiries relating to the cessation of performance in Toyota distant entry units. This part seeks to make clear potential causes and troubleshooting approaches.

Query 1: Is the distant entry gadget definitively irreparable if it ceases to perform?

Not essentially. The preliminary plan of action includes battery substitute. If the gadget stays non-functional following battery substitute, synchronization points or extra advanced inside malfunctions could also be current, requiring skilled diagnostic analysis.

Query 2: Can excessive temperatures have an effect on the distant entry gadget’s efficiency?

Sure. Extended publicity to excessive warmth or chilly can impression battery efficiency and doubtlessly harm inside digital elements, leading to diminished operational functionality or outright failure.

Query 3: Does aftermarket set up of digital units in a Toyota car have an effect on the distant entry gadget’s reliability?

Doubtlessly. Improper set up of aftermarket electronics can intervene with the car’s electrical system and, in some situations, disrupt the sign or perform of the distant entry system. Skilled set up is advisable to mitigate such dangers.

Query 4: How steadily ought to the distant entry gadget’s battery get replaced?

Battery substitute frequency depends upon utilization and environmental elements. Typically, a battery lifespan of 1 to 2 years is typical. Indicators of weakening sign power, reminiscent of diminished working vary, point out the necessity for substitute.

Query 5: Is there a way to find out if the problem lies with the distant entry gadget or the car’s receiver?

Diagnostic gear is usually required to precisely isolate the issue. Knowledgeable technician can use scan instruments to evaluate the receiver’s performance and make sure whether or not it’s correctly receiving the distant entry gadget’s sign.

Query 6: Can a distant entry gadget from one other Toyota car be reprogrammed to function a unique Toyota?

Reprogramming a distant entry gadget from one car to a different is usually not possible because of the distinctive identification codes assigned to every gadget. Making an attempt such reprogramming might lead to system malfunction.

Addressing a Non-Useful Toyota Distant Entry Gadget

The next includes a collection of advisable actions when confronted with a Toyota distant entry gadget ceasing to function. These steps are designed to supply systematic troubleshooting.

Tip 1: Exchange the Battery. Probably the most frequent trigger is battery depletion. A CR2032 battery is usually used. Alternative is a simple course of. Guarantee correct battery polarity throughout set up.

Tip 2: Look at Gadget for Bodily Harm. Examine the gadget for cracks, damaged buttons, or indicators of water intrusion. If bodily harm is clear, the gadget could require skilled restore or substitute.

Tip 3: Try Resynchronization. Seek advice from the car’s proprietor’s handbook for the particular resynchronization process. This usually includes turning the ignition on and off in a particular sequence whereas urgent buttons on the gadget.

Tip 4: Examine Car Battery Situation. A weakened car battery can not directly have an effect on the distant entry system’s efficiency. Make sure the car’s battery is satisfactorily charged and in good situation.

Tip 5: Take into account Potential Sign Interference. Exterior radio frequency interference can disrupt communication. Transfer the car to a unique location to rule out interference because the trigger.

Tip 6: Seek the advice of a Skilled Technician. If the previous steps fail to revive performance, a system fault could also be current. A certified technician can diagnose and restore advanced points inside the car’s digital techniques.

Tip 7: Evaluate Guarantee. Sure prolonged warranties could cowl points involving malfunctioning key fobs. Checking the paperwork associated to the car and the prolonged guarantee is essential because the repairing course of is pricey.

Adhering to those steps supplies a structured method to resolving points with the distant entry gadget. Prioritizing preventative measures extends operational lifespan.
